WebFeb 1, 2024 · High-speed steel is available in M and T types (Molybdenum and Tungsten) and provides better performance than carbon steel. Tungsten Carbide tool bits are an alternative which last longer, but these are more brittle. Speeds The cutting speed is the most important factor for extending tool life. High Efficiency Milling can be a very effective machining technique in stainless steels if the correct tools are selected. Chipbreaker roughers would make an excellent choice, in either 5 or 7 flute styles, while standard 5-7 flute, variable pitch end mills can also perform well in HEM toolpaths.. HEV-5.
